Sandown to inspect
Officials at Sandown have called an inspection at 3.00pm tomorrow afternoon to determine prospects for Friday’s card, which features the Royal Artillery Gold Cup.
Clerk of the course Andrew Cooper rates the chances of the meeting getting the go-ahead as “50-50” after 20 millimetres of rain fell at the Esher track overnight and this morning, bringing the threat of waterlogging.
He said: “It is not raceable at the moment as there are several areas of waterlogged ground. There isn’t much surface water, but there are wet stretches, and by 3pm we should be able to take stock. We are expecting to stay dry until Friday morning.”
